NPR exclusive: The role the U.S. has played in the humanitarian crisis in Gaza
Summary
NPR released a report about how the United States has influenced the situation in Gaza, particularly the ongoing humanitarian crisis. The report includes interviews with former U.S. officials who question whether they did enough to help prevent the crisis.Key Facts
- NPR conducted a report focusing on the United States' influence on the humanitarian crisis in Gaza.
- The situation in Gaza involves severe food shortages.
- Former U.S. officials were interviewed for the report.
- These officials expressed concerns about whether enough preventive actions were taken.
- The report is part of NPR's "All Things Considered" program.
- The crisis in Gaza has raised questions about international and U.S. policy effectiveness.
